val f_reduceIndexedOrNull = fn("reduceIndexedOrNull(operation: (index: Int, acc: T, T) -> T)") {
include(ArraysOfPrimitives, ArraysOfUnsigned, CharSequences)
} builder {
since("1.4")
inline()
specialFor(ArraysOfUnsigned) { inlineOnly() }
doc {
"""
Accumulates value starting with the first ${f.element} and applying [operation] from left to right
to current accumulator value and each ${f.element} with its index in the original ${f.collection}.
Returns null if the ${f.collection} is empty.
@param [operation] function that takes the index of ${f.element.prefixWithArticle()}, current accumulator value
and the ${f.element} itself and calculates the next accumulator value.
"""
}
sample("samples.collections.Collections.Aggregates.reduceOrNull")
returns("T?")
body {
"""
if (isEmpty())
return null
var accumulator = this[0]
for (index in 1..lastIndex) {
accumulator = operation(index, accumulator, this[index])
}
return accumulator
"""
}
}

val f_reduceRightIndexedOrNull = fn("reduceRightIndexedOrNull(operation: (index: Int, T, acc: T) -> T)") {
include(CharSequences, ArraysOfPrimitives, ArraysOfUnsigned)
} builder {
since("1.4")
inline()
specialFor(ArraysOfUnsigned) { inlineOnly() }
doc {
"""
Accumulates value starting with last ${f.element} and applying [operation] from right to left
to each ${f.element} with its index in the original ${f.collection} and current accumulator value.
Returns null if the ${f.collection} is empty.
@param [operation] function that takes the index of ${f.element.prefixWithArticle()}, the ${f.element} itself
and current accumulator value, and calculates the next accumulator value.
"""
}
sample("samples.collections.Collections.Aggregates.reduceRightOrNull")
returns("T?")
body {
"""
var index = lastIndex
if (index < 0) return null
var accumulator = get(index--)
while (index >= 0) {
accumulator = operation(index, get(index), accumulator)
--index
}
return accumulator
"""
}
}
